The Ahmadu Bello University Zaria, popularly known as ABU is a Federal University in located Zaria, Kaduna State, Nigeria. It was founded on 4 October 1962, as the University of Northern Nigeria. In today’s article, I will list you 150 notable alumni of ABU and their careers.

ABU is one of the best and oldest universities in Nigeria. It operates two campuses (Samaru main campus and Kongo campus, both located in Zaria).

Being the best federal university in the country, ABU owns pre-degree school which is located in Funtua, a few kilometres away from the main campus, Samaru, Zaria.

Meanwhile, the Samaru campus contains the administrative offices including senate building and the faculties of physical sciences, life sciences, social sciences, arts and languages, education, environmental design, engineering, medical sciences, agricultural sciences and research facilities.

The Kongo campus of ABU Zaria houses the faculties of Law and Administration. ABU Faculty of Administration has the following undergraduate courses:

  • Accounting
  • Business Administration
  • Local Government and Development Studies and
  • Public Administration Departments..

ABU Zaria is named after the first premier of Northern Nigeria, Alhaji Sir Ahmadu Bello on 4th October, 1962.

The university runs a wide variety of undergraduate and postgraduate programmes (and offers associate degrees and vocational and remedial programmes). ABU Teaching Hospital is one of the largest teaching hospitals in Nigeria and Africa, Ahmadu Bello University (ABU) offers the best medical courses in its academic programmes.
